DURBAN, Oct 15: Shaun Pollock could miss the wills International Cup One-day tournament in Bangladesh later this month because of a mystery back injury.
Pollock visited a specialist for the third time in two weeks for tests which, it is hoped, will finally shed light on the nature and extent of the injury.
Shedlock said he considered it unwise to keep Pollock in the South African squad for the Dhaka tournament starting on October 24. It involves all nine Test playing countries.
“Considering the five Tests we will play against the West Indies this summer, not to mention all the one-day internationals, i think pollock should stay at home and rest instead of going to bangladesh," shedlock said.
Pollock sustained what was termed a minor back strain in a match last month. When he underwent a scan no major damage was revealed.
Another visit to a different specialist yielded similarly reassuring but vague results.
Shedlock hopes the problem will be diagnosed when the latest in-depth test results areavailable.
